Azure AI Vision (formerly Azure Computer Vision) is a unified service that offers computer vision capabilities that give apps the ability to analyze images, read text, and detect faces with prebuilt image tagging, text extraction with optical character recognition (OCR), and responsible facial recognition. It is used to incorporate vision features into projects with no machine learning experience required.N/A

Intel® RealSense™ Stereo depth technology brings 3D to devices and machines that only see 2D today. Stereo image sensing technologies use two cameras to calculate depth and enable devices to see, understand, interact with, and learn from their environment — to drive intuitive, natural interaction and immersion.N/A
